My Latitude D610 power flicks on off on off The touchpad freezes. Keyboard skips letters. I bought this used from Dell. No warranty. New power cord.

In my opinion, it sounds like a motherboard issue. The keyboard skips would indicate that the keyboard is not always getting the inofrmation to the CPU. If it freezes, it may be overheating.

Latitude D610 PC Notebook: I am looking for the Dell Latitude D610 serial Num...

On the bottom, labeled SERVICE TAG 7 digits, numbers and letters
also located in the system BIOS
